Track days are exciting events where car enthusiasts push their vehicles to the limit. However, high engine speeds can cause damage if not properly managed. Setting RPM limits is an effective way to protect your engine during these intense sessions.
Understanding RPM Limits
Revolutions Per Minute (RPM) indicates how many times the engine's crankshaft completes a full rotation each minute. Exceeding safe RPM levels can lead to engine wear, overheating, or catastrophic failure. Therefore, establishing a maximum RPM is crucial for engine longevity during track days.
How to Set RPM Limits
Most modern vehicles equipped for track use have electronic control units (ECUs) that allow you to set RPM limits. Follow these steps to configure your RPM limiter:
- Consult your vehicle's manual to find the recommended maximum RPM.
- Use a diagnostic tool or tuning software compatible with your ECU.
- Connect the tool to your vehicle's OBD-II port.
- Access the engine tuning settings within the software.
- Set the RPM limit slightly below the maximum safe RPM to provide a margin of safety.
- Save and upload the new settings to your ECU.
Additional Tips for Track Day Safety
Setting RPM limits is just one part of protecting your engine. Consider the following additional precautions:
- Regularly check and maintain your cooling system.
- Ensure your oil and filters are fresh and appropriate for high-performance driving.
- Monitor engine temperature and other vital signs during the session.
- Practice smooth throttle inputs to avoid sudden spikes in RPM.
By properly setting and respecting RPM limits, you can enjoy track days while keeping your engine safe and reliable for future events.
